End of World 2018: Myths, Facts, and What Really Happened

Global attention in 2018 centered on escalating geopolitical risks, climate data releases, and technology disruptions that reshaped public discourse about long term stability. Many analysts revisited scenarios that had once been dismissed as fringe, asking whether converging crises could tip the world into a more fragile state.

Although widespread catastrophe did not occur in 2018, policy shifts, market turbulence, and scientific warnings created a template for how societies interpret and respond to complex risk indicators. This overview examines the narratives, indicators, and institutional reactions that framed the year as a turning point in collective risk perception.

Geopolitical Fragmentation and Conflict Triggers

Trade disputes, nuclear diplomacy, and regional interventions dominated headlines, highlighting how quickly diplomatic channels could erode. Analysts examined historical parallels where miscommunication and domestic politics combined to raise the risk of unintended escalation.

Within this context, the concept of end of world 2018 became a shorthand for testing whether systemic safeguards could absorb shocks that previous eras would have treated as existential. Experts focused on concrete diplomatic metrics rather than speculative scenarios, which helped anchor public debate in measurable developments.

Nuclear Deterrence Modernization and Risks

Arms control agreements faced strain as major powers pursued upgrades to nuclear arsenals and new delivery systems. Critics warned that relaxed doctrinal thresholds and emerging hypersonic technologies could compress decision windows during crises.

For communities concerned with end of world 2018 narratives, these modernization programs illustrated how technical upgrades in military infrastructure alter perceived stability, even when actual use of weapons remained unlikely.

Climate Extremes and Infrastructure Stress

Record heatwaves, intensified storms, and prolonged droughts in 2018 demonstrated how climate impacts translate into economic losses and migration pressures. Policymakers began aligning adaptation budgets with climate risk models that had previously been treated as theoretical.

Infrastructure operators revised standards for flood resilience and energy reliability, linking local engineering choices to broader narratives about societal resilience in the face of environmental change.

Technology Disruption and Governance Gaps

Platform moderation, data harvesting, and automated decision systems exposed gaps in legal frameworks designed for a slower technological cycle. Regulators responded with sector specific rules that foreshadowed more comprehensive approaches to digital governance.

Observers of end of world 2018 debates argued that the speed of technological change could amplify misinformation and systemic failures, making institutional agility a critical determinant of long term stability.

Did 2018 mark the beginning of an irreversible decline in global cooperation?

No, while cooperation faced clear challenges, multilateral institutions continued to function and new coalitions formed on issues such as climate and data privacy.

How did trade tensions in 2018 affect ordinary consumers?

Tariffs and supply chain adjustments contributed to higher prices for certain goods and reduced choice in specific markets, though competition limited the scale of impact.

What measurable shifts occurred in climate policy after 2018 events?

Many countries committed to stricter emissions targets and climate risk disclosures, integrating scientific recommendations into budget and planning cycles.

Why did technology regulation accelerate after 2018?

Major data breaches and high profile platform controversies triggered public demand for accountability, prompting regulators to set baseline safeguards for users.
